Sink Snaking in Denver, CO
Sink snaking services involve using specialized tools to clear blockages and obstructions within household drains, particularly in sinks, kitchen lines, and bathroom fixtures. This process is commonly requested for issues such as slow drainage, foul odors, or recurring clogs, and can address a variety of projects including kitchen sink backups, bathroom drain obstructions, or main sewer line issues. Homeowners should understand that the service targets removing debris, grease buildup, hair, or other materials that cause flow restrictions, helping to restore proper drainage and prevent future problems.
Property owners interested in sink snaking should consider the nature and location of the clog, as well as the age and condition of the plumbing system. It is helpful to know if multiple fixtures are affected simultaneously or if the issue is localized to a single drain. Additionally, understanding the history of drain problems or previous repairs can assist in determining whether snaking is an appropriate solution. Properly diagnosing the cause of the blockage can ensure the most effective approach and help maintain the plumbing system’s functionality over time.

Sink Snaking Questions
What is sink snaking? Sink snaking involves using a flexible auger to clear clogs and blockages in drain pipes beneath the sink.
When should sink snaking be used? Sink snaking is effective when slow draining or standing water indicates a clog that cannot be removed with simple plunging.
Is sink snaking safe for all types of pipes? Yes, sink snaking is generally safe for most residential plumbing, but it should be performed carefully to avoid damage.
What types of blockages can sink snaking clear? It can remove hair, soap buildup, grease, and other debris causing drain obstructions.
